Blizzard’s latest Diablo 4 footage makes Lord of Hatred look even darker

A new 12-minute gameplay video shows the expansion's opening battle at sea and teases major skill tree and endgame changes.

Blizzard has released 12 minutes of Diablo 4: Lord of Hatred gameplay as the expansion heads toward its April 28, 2026 launch. The footage gives a closer look at the opening stretch of the DLC and the kind of chaos players can expect when Mephisto’s story continues.

The new video opens with the player character boarding a ship that is quickly overwhelmed by monsters. From there, the fight moves through the lower decks and then back onto the broken top of the vessel for a showdown with what looks like a sea-born monster.

The footage follows a run of excellent news for the expansion. Blizzard has already said the Paladin class will be available through early access for players who buy the deluxe or ultimate edition, while the Warlock will join the roster when the expansion arrives. Blizzard is also planning a broad skill tree rework alongside Lord of Hatred, plus major changes to endgame content. That means this expansion is not just about a new campaign beat, but also a wider systems pass that will affect how players build characters and tackle late-game activities.
